Java导出SQL语句是一项非常重要的技能,它可以帮助开发人员更加高效地完成数据库操作。通过Java导出SQL语句,开发人员可以快速地生成SQL语句,并将其用于数据库操作。下面将介绍Java导出SQL语句的相关知识。
_x000D_一、什么是Java导出SQL语句?
_x000D_Java导出SQL语句是指使用Java编程语言生成SQL语句的过程。通过Java导出SQL语句,开发人员可以快速地生成SQL语句,并将其用于数据库操作。Java导出SQL语句可以帮助开发人员更加高效地完成数据库操作,提高开发效率。
_x000D_二、Java导出SQL语句的步骤
_x000D_Java导出SQL语句的步骤如下:
_x000D_1.连接数据库:在Java中连接数据库的方式有很多种,可以使用JDBC、Hibernate等框架。在连接数据库之前,需要先加载数据库驱动程序。
_x000D_2.创建SQL语句:创建SQL语句是Java导出SQL语句的核心步骤。在创建SQL语句时,需要考虑SQL语句的结构、参数、变量等因素。
_x000D_3.执行SQL语句:执行SQL语句是Java导出SQL语句的最后一步。在执行SQL语句时,需要注意SQL语句的安全性和效率。
_x000D_三、Java导出SQL语句的优点
_x000D_Java导出SQL语句有以下优点:
_x000D_1.高效:Java导出SQL语句可以帮助开发人员快速地生成SQL语句,提高开发效率。
_x000D_2.可维护性:Java导出SQL语句可以帮助开发人员更好地维护SQL语句,避免SQL语句的错误和漏洞。
_x000D_3.可复用性:Java导出SQL语句可以帮助开发人员更好地复用SQL语句,提高代码的可重用性。
_x000D_四、Java导出SQL语句的应用场景
_x000D_Java导出SQL语句可以应用于以下场景:
_x000D_1.数据查询:Java导出SQL语句可以帮助开发人员更快地查询数据库中的数据。
_x000D_2.数据更新:Java导出SQL语句可以帮助开发人员更快地更新数据库中的数据。
_x000D_3.数据删除:Java导出SQL语句可以帮助开发人员更快地删除数据库中的数据。
_x000D_五、Java导出SQL语句的注意事项
_x000D_Java导出SQL语句需要注意以下事项:
_x000D_1.安全性:Java导出SQL语句需要注意SQL注入等安全问题。
_x000D_2.效率:Java导出SQL语句需要注意SQL语句的效率,避免出现性能问题。
_x000D_3.可读性:Java导出SQL语句需要注意SQL语句的可读性,避免出现难以理解的语句。
_x000D_六、Java导出SQL语句的实例
_x000D_下面是一个Java导出SQL语句的实例:
_x000D_`java
_x000D_import java.sql.*;
_x000D_public class JdbcTest {
_x000D_public static void main(String[] args) {
_x000D_Connection conn = null;
_x000D_Statement stmt = null;
_x000D_ResultSet rs = null;
_x000D_try {
_x000D_Class.forName("com.mysql.jdbc.Driver");
_x000D_conn = DriverManager.getConnection("jdbc:mysql://localhost:3306/test", "root", "123456");
_x000D_stmt = conn.createStatement();
_x000D_String sql = "select * from user";
_x000D_rs = stmt.executeQuery(sql);
_x000D_while (rs.next()) {
_x000D_String name = rs.getString("name");
_x000D_String age = rs.getString("age");
_x000D_System.out.println("name:" + name + ", age:" + age);
_x000D_}
_x000D_} catch (ClassNotFoundException e) {
_x000D_e.printStackTrace();
_x000D_} catch (SQLException e) {
_x000D_e.printStackTrace();
_x000D_} finally {
_x000D_try {
_x000D_if (rs != null) rs.close();
_x000D_if (stmt != null) stmt.close();
_x000D_if (conn != null) conn.close();
_x000D_} catch (SQLException e) {
_x000D_e.printStackTrace();
_x000D_}
_x000D_}
_x000D_}
_x000D_ _x000D_七、Java导出SQL语句的相关问答
_x000D_1. Java导出SQL语句有哪些优点?
_x000D_Java导出SQL语句有高效、可维护性、可复用性等优点。
_x000D_2. Java导出SQL语句的步骤是什么?
_x000D_Java导出SQL语句的步骤是连接数据库、创建SQL语句、执行SQL语句。
_x000D_3. Java导出SQL语句的应用场景有哪些?
_x000D_Java导出SQL语句可以应用于数据查询、数据更新、数据删除等场景。
_x000D_4. Java导出SQL语句需要注意哪些事项?
_x000D_Java导出SQL语句需要注意安全性、效率、可读性等问题。
_x000D_Java导出SQL语句是一项非常重要的技能,它可以帮助开发人员更加高效地完成数据库操作。通过Java导出SQL语句,开发人员可以快速地生成SQL语句,并将其用于数据库操作。希望本文对您有所帮助。
_x000D_